Bill Parcells Has Done His Homework
Bill Parcells Has Done His Homework
Ricky Williams has looked like the best player for the Dolphins this offseason (yeah, not saying much). Obviously the Dolphins want to keep him happy and productive, and it looks like Bill Parcells has done his research. The Miami Herald reports : Off the field, Parcells has mentored Ricky Williams.
